The street in brief

Ray Close is a street almost entirely of terraced houses. Homes here typically change hands around £228,000 — roughly 52% below the RH7 norm. Too few recent sales to read a street-level trend, but across RH7 prices have been rising over the last few years. The record shows 5 sales across 2 homes since 2002.
